TREATLIFE Smart Ceiling Fan Control and Dimmer Light Switch

The TREATLIFE Smart Ceiling Fan Control and Dimmer Light Switch stands out as an excellent choice for homeowners seeking a reliable, app-controlled solution that offers seamless fan speed and lighting adjustments. It supports 2.4GHz Wi-Fi, no hub needed, and works with Alexa, Google Assistant, and SmartThings. Installation requires careful wiring, including neutral and load wires, and isn’t compatible with multi-way circuits or non-dimmable bulbs. Once installed, it provides smooth dimming, four fan speeds, and remote control via the app. While larger than standard switches, its durability and easy voice control make it a versatile addition for modern smart homes.

Best For: homeowners looking for a reliable, app-controlled ceiling fan and dimmer switch compatible with Alexa, Google Assistant, and SmartThings, but not requiring a hub or HomeKit.

Pros:

  • Supports 4 fan speeds and flicker-free dimming for smooth lighting adjustments
  • Easy remote control and scheduling via the TreatLife or Smart Life app
  • Compatible with multiple voice assistants including Alexa, Google Assistant, and SmartThings

Cons:

  • Larger size may require extra space in the electrical box during installation
  • Not compatible with multi-way circuits, non-dimmable bulbs, or smart bulbs
  • Requires careful wiring and is incompatible with 14-2 wiring lacking a second load wire

Enbrighten Z-Wave Plus Fan Control

Enbrighten Z-Wave Plus Fan Control stands out for anyone seeking reliable remote control over ceiling fans, especially those already using a Z-Wave smart home system. It replaces standard switches, allowing remote on/off and adjustable speed settings—high, medium, low. You can control and schedule up to two fans from a single switch, making it perfect for multi-fan setups. Its built-in repeater extends Z-Wave signals up to 150 feet, improving coverage and reliability. With customizable paddles in white and light almond, it blends seamlessly into your decor. Note that it’s designed solely for fan control and requires a Z-Wave hub for operation.

Best For: homeowners with a Z-Wave smart home system seeking reliable remote control and adjustable speed settings for ceiling fans.

Pros:

  • Supports remote on/off and multi-speed control (high, medium, low) for ceiling fans.
  • Includes a built-in repeater that extends Z-Wave signal range up to 150 feet, improving network coverage.
  • Customizable paddles in white and light almond for seamless integration with home decor.

Cons:

  • Designed solely for fan speed control; cannot be used for controlling lighting without additional switches.
  • Requires a compatible Z-Wave hub for operation, adding to setup complexity.
  • Not suitable for fans with incompatible wiring setups or those needing integrated lighting control.

Compatibility With Fans

Choosing a headwind fan smart control starts with making sure it’s compatible with your fan’s motor type, voltage, and wiring. Different fans use split capacitor or shaded pole motors, so I check that the control supports my motor type to avoid malfunctions. I also verify that it matches my fan’s voltage and wattage ratings, typically around 1.5A for residential fans. Space is another consideration—I measure my fan’s canopy or housing to ensure the device fits, especially if I have a low-profile or hug- ceiling fan. Additionally, I confirm the control supports my wiring setup, including whether a neutral wire is needed. Finally, I look for wireless compatibility, like Bluetooth or Wi-Fi, to ensure seamless integration with my existing network and setup.

Installation Requirements

When selecting a smart control for your Headwind fan, ensuring compatibility with the fan’s existing control system is essential. Check that your fan supports integration with smart controls, such as standard in-ceiling switches or remote systems. Make sure there’s enough space within the fan canopy or mounting area to install the control device or receiver comfortably. Confirm that your fan’s wiring includes all necessary wires—neutral, load, line, and ground—to support the smart control kit. Additionally, verify that your fan’s motor type and wiring configuration meet the control device’s requirements, especially if it supports features like 3-speed operation. Finally, review the installation instructions to determine if any special tools or electrical expertise are needed for a smooth, safe setup.
